Yvonne Strahovski Joins I, Frankenstein

Set to begin production shortly in Victoria, Australia, Stuart Beattie’s I, Frankenstein is in the process of rounding out its cast. Deadline now reports that another key role has been filled: Yvonne Strahovski will play the female lead.

The film tells the modern-day tale of Dr. Frankenstein’s creature, Adam, who nearly centuries after his “birth”, has found himself in a gothic city, caught up in a war between two immortal clans. Though based on the comic by Kevin Grevioux, leading man Aaron Eckhart recently explained to ComingSoon.net that Mary Shelley’s original novel is where he’s currently focusing his attention to build the character.

Stahovski, best known for her role on NBC’s “Chuck”, will play a scientist and will serve as a romantic interest to Eckhart’s Adam.

Recent reports also suggest that Bill Nighy will be joining the production as the film’s villain and that Socratis Otto will play Nighy’s character’s assistant.

I, Frankenstein is set to be released on February 22, 2013.

UPDATE: The Hollywood Reporter now has word that Miranda Otto has also joined the cast. She’ll play the Queen of the gargoyles and a friend to Adam.
